Only enable access policy when server response is 401?

We have a site that is a mix of anonymous and authenticated content. The authenticated content lives all over within the site and is maintained by hundreds of content editors, so there's really no pattern to look for in the URL to determine when a user needs to be authenticated. We are migrating from ISA 2006 and we currently rely on the server to throw a 401 challenge before asking for credentials. Is there a way to do this with the F5?

 

Various business decisions have led us down the path of mixing content and it's critical that we solve this issue in order to continue migrating over to the F5. As we have the F5 APM configured right now, it's kind of all or nothing. Once you hit the site through APM, you're prompted for credentials even if the page you requested is anonymous.

  • My thoughts on this are that you likely will have to craft an iRule that sets ACCESS::disable by default, except if the server response is a 401 or some other condition.

    TO add to Josh's suggestion.

     

    If you see the 401 from the server in HTTP_RESPONSE, add some cookie or other marker and redirect client back to the VIP. If the cookie or other marker is seen, then do ACCESS::enable.

  • With help from an F5 engineer, I was able to get this working as I needed. The base of the iRule that I ended up using to get my situation solved is below. This is essentially what the F5 engineer sent along:

    when HTTP_REQUEST {
         store the host header for the initial /start_policy redirect
        set host [HTTP::host]
        set uri [HTTP::uri]
        if { ( [HTTP::cookie exists MRHSession] ) or ( [HTTP::uri] starts_with "/start_policy" ) } {
             initial redirect to /start_policy (starts access policy evaluation) - or a normal post-policy request
            set apm_req 1
            return
        } else {
             APM session disabled until logon process is started
            ACCESS::disable
            set apm_req 0
            return
        }
    }
    when ACCESS_SESSION_STARTED {
         store the initial (redirect URI) until it's needed
        ACCESS::session data set session.cms.starturi [findstr [HTTP::uri] "/start_policy=" 14]
        ACCESS::session data set session.cms.starthost [HTTP::host] 
    } 
    
    when ACCESS_POLICY_COMPLETED {
         log local0. "host was [ACCESS::session data get session.cms.starthost]"
         log local0. "uri was [ACCESS::session data get session.cms.starturi]"
         ACCESS::respond 301 Location "https://[ACCESS::session data get session.cms.starthost][ACCESS::session data get session.cms.starturi]" 
    
    }
    when HTTP_RESPONSE {  
        log local0. "apm_req was $apm_req"   
         capture the redirect to authenticate
        if {  ([HTTP::status] eq "401") and ($apm_req eq 0) } {
             initiate access policy processing
            log local0. "apm_req was $apm_req so redirecting"
             HTTP::respond 302 Location "https://${host}/start_policy=$uri"
        }
    }

  • Hi,

     

    this iRule permit to start authentication process only if the server respond a 401 code. but, if the user want to go back to an unauthenticated content, APM is requesting authentication until the cookie is removed.

     

    the following modified iRule permit the user to go back to an unauthenticated page by checking the state of session. I changed the variable landinguri instead of creating the variable session.cms.starturi to remove ACCESS_POLICY_COMPLETED event.

     

    when HTTP_REQUEST {
         store the host header for the initial /start_policy redirect
        set uri [HTTP::uri]
        set logout_req 0
        set apm_cookie [HTTP::cookie value MRHSession]
        if { ( [ACCESS::session exists -state_allow $apm_cookie] ) \
                 or ( [HTTP::uri] starts_with "/my.policy" ) } {
             initial redirect to /my.policy (starts access policy evaluation) - or a normal post-policy request
            set apm_req 1
            return
        } elseif { ( [HTTP::uri] starts_with "/start_policy" ) } {
             initial redirect to /start_policy (starts access policy evaluation)
             Remove the not established previous sessions
            ACCESS::session remove
            ACCESS::session create -timeout 1800 -lifetime 0
            ACCESS::session data set session.server.landinguri [findstr [HTTP::uri] "/start_policy?url=" 18]
            set apm_req 1
            return
        } else {
             APM session disabled until logon process is started
            ACCESS::disable
            set apm_req 0
            return
        }
    }
    when ACCESS_SESSION_STARTED {
         store the initial (redirect URI) until it's needed
        ACCESS::session data set session.server.landinguri [findstr [HTTP::uri] "/start_policy?url" 18]
    }
    
    when HTTP_RESPONSE { 
        log local0. "apm_req was $apm_req"  
         capture the redirect to authenticate
        if {  ([HTTP::status] eq "401") and ($apm_req eq 0) } {
             initiate access policy processing
            log local0. "apm_req was $apm_req so redirecting"
             HTTP::respond 302 Location "/start_policy?url=$uri"
        }
    }
